The highlight of the shower was the mimosa bar! Champagne with different juices and fruit garnishes. I loved the glow ice cubes in the juice; it reminds me of Disneyland drinks!
Bridesmaid and Disneyland Bride Katie decorated with flowers from the Downtown LA flower market to save money. The flowers and lanterns looked great!
Katie also made this wonderful backdrop with fabric from Joann Fabric and Crafts.
